What is Homecare?<br />

Homecare complements specialist nursing care, wheather from district nursing, wheather one is in ones individual<br />

home or in a care facility.<br />

This service includes training in the individual products and delivery of the medical supplies that are explanatory.<br />

For example medical nutrition, ostomy or wound care.<br />

The aim is to offer people maximum comfort and quality of life by having the Homecare Manager bring professional<br />

support, advice and the necessary medical aids directly to their home or ensure that they are delivered.<br />

The Homecare manager establishes, through networking, communication to all people and institutions involved in<br />

the patients care and use of the specific medical aids. Even if this includes the transfer from inpatient to outpatient<br />

care and comuncation with the health insurance comanies, privat or not.<br />

These services should always be seen as complementary to nursing or social services and should not be confused<br />

with outpatient nursingcare or nursingcare in a care facility.<br />

Our Patient Advisory Board<br />

<strong>GHD</strong> focuses on dialogue and founded a Patient Advisory Board in 2021. Five advisors, as affected individuals, represent<br />

the intrests of patients and their families.<br />

„The Patient in Focus“ initiative stregthens <strong>GHD</strong>´s commitment to be a pioneer in nationwide patient care with, medical<br />

aids and medications througout Germany.<br />

Our goal: we want to understand the needs and wishes of our patients even better.<br />
